Thought for the Day - Why We Allow Only Some to Hurt Us

It's interesting. But we allow only some people to hurt us. Most others we don't care but there are a few people in our lives who we give the power to (most times with no real reason).
With these people who we give the power to - we feel they have understood us (or perhaps we would like to believe that they understand us). And in our desire to be understood and to understand them, we open ourselves up, show our most vulnerable selves and voila- even a whiff of air that goes the other way hurts.

Why we do that is perhaps our desire to have someone understand us to the level of vulnerability we have opened up to. But that's not their problem - it's ours. We cannot trade our vulnerability to their understanding. 

What's the solution? I guess it's to understand ourselves first and not expect the world to understand us. By that I mean that we choose not to get hurt but still be open and vulnerable. 

It's a fine balance - needs practice. A lot of practice. And understanding of our self.
